A Type Battery Cage vs Chore-Time: 2026 Cost-Effectiveness vs Premium Performance Framework – Detailed Comparison for Layer Farms
Key Comparison Points for Layer Farms
Both systems support automated layer production, but they differ in upfront cost, maintenance ease, scalability for medium farms, and export suitability. The choice depends on budget, farm size, and long-term goals.
Cost-Effectiveness vs Premium Performance Matrix (2025-2026 Industry Benchmark)
| Factor | A Type Battery Cage | Chore-Time System | Advantage |
|---|---|---|---|
| Initial Cost | Lower (30-40% less) | Higher | A Type |
| Maintenance Ease | Simple | More complex | A Type |
| Scalability for Medium Farms | Excellent | Good | A Type |
| ROI Timeline | 12-18 months | 18-24 months | A Type |
| Egg Production | 280-300 eggs/hen/year | 285-305 eggs/hen/year | Chore-Time |
